






St John’s House Residential Care Home in Kirk Hammerton, near York provides residential care for up to 34 residents in a beautiful Tudor style building dating back to 1910. This includes long-term, short-term and respite care.
All the rooms are en-suite and residents can also access several lounges, dining rooms and reception rooms, as well as two acres of beautiful country grounds.

Inspection ratings
We rate most services according to how safe, effective, caring, responsive and well-led they are, using four levels:
- Outstanding - The service is performing exceptionally well.
- Good - The service is performing well and meeting our expectations.
- Requires Improvement - The service isn't performing as well as it should and we have told the service how it must improve.
- Inadequate - The service is performing badly and we've taken action against the person or organisation that runs it.
- Not rated - we have not yet rated this area of the service, this is normally because the assessments we have carried out have been focused on other key questions.
